In what has been dubbed the biggest selfie at sea, Carnival Cruise Lines' ambassador Shannan Ponton along with hundreds of Carnival Spirit guests struck a pose on the ship's top decks.

More than 600 people packed the decks during a cruise from Sydney to New Caledonia, to take part in the health and fitness guru's Biggest Bootcamp at Sea.

Those jumping in the epic ship selfie gave a gold coin donation which goes towards Ponton's chosen charity CanTeen, which provides support for young people living with cancer.

Ponton is also raising money for CanTeen during morning walks around the deck with Carnival Spirit cruise director Stu Dunn.

The fitness guru, who has been onboard the 10-day New Caledonia cruise helping cruisers stay fit and healthy during their sojourn at sea, with special classes, walks and lectures, is the cruise line's first Australian ambassador.

His next cruise will be an eight-night cruise to New Caledonia on Carnival Spirit on 12 August 2014.
